The Solar Panel Monitoring System Market, is expected to reach USD 1,370.9 Million in 2030 by growing at a CAGR of 15.2%.
The global push for clean and sustainable energy has fueled significant growth in the Solar Panel Monitoring System market, which is projected to reach USD 1,370.9 million by 2030, growing at an impressive CAGR of 15.2%. As the adoption of solar energy systems accelerates worldwide, there is an increasing need for intelligent monitoring solutions to maximize energy efficiency and ensure optimal performance.
Driving Forces Behind the Market Growth
Surge in Clean Energy Investments
One of the main drivers of the solar panel monitoring system market is the rising investment in renewable energy, particularly solar power. Governments and private entities alike are prioritizing clean energy to meet environmental targets, reduce carbon emissions, and comply with global agreements like the Paris Climate Accord. This shift has significantly boosted the demand for monitoring systems that can optimize energy production and reduce maintenance costs.
Technological Advancements in Solar Panels
The market has seen rapid advancements in solar technologies, including improvements in photovoltaic (PV) efficiency and integration with IoT-enabled devices. These innovations allow real-time performance tracking, predictive maintenance, and energy loss detection—making solar panel monitoring systems essential for both residential and commercial applications.
Growing Preference for Cleaner Energy Sources
As environmental awareness grows, consumers are increasingly opting for sustainable energy alternatives. Solar energy, being one of the most accessible and eco-friendly options, has seen widespread adoption. This, in turn, is pushing the need for smart monitoring systems to ensure the effectiveness and reliability of solar installations.
Government Incentives and Supportive Policies
Governments across the globe are actively supporting the solar industry through subsidies, tax incentives, and regulatory frameworks. For instance:

United States introduced the Inflation Reduction Act in 2022, expanding support for renewable energy through tax credits.
European Union raised its 2030 renewable energy target to 45% under the REPowerEU Plan, aiming for 600 GW of solar PV capacity.
China’s 14th Five-Year Plan sets a goal of 33% electricity from renewables by 2025, with a significant focus on solar.
India committed to 500 GW of non-fossil capacity by 2030, with solar PV playing a major role.

Global Trends and Market Outlook
Countries worldwide are embracing solar energy as a reliable and scalable solution to meet energy demands. For example, the U.S. solar market has seen an average 33% annual growth rate over the past decade, with more than 140 GW of solar capacity installed—enough to power 25 million homes. This trend is expected to continue as solar becomes increasingly affordable and accessible.
Moreover, falling prices of solar panels and improvements in energy storage solutions (like lithium-ion batteries) are expected to fuel even greater adoption. The integration of AI, cloud-based analytics, and remote diagnostics into solar panel monitoring is another trend shaping the future of this market.
